We’re In Digital, a thriving digital growth agency based in Covent Garden and ranked as one of the best places to work in the UK – and we’re currently seeking a Marketing Technology Manager to join our brilliant team of marketers!

As Manager you will collaborate with top talent and work on exciting campaigns for prestigious brands such as the Financial Times, The Independent or Experian.

Who we’re looking for – at a glance:

  • A senior Marketing Technology specialist, used to setting the agenda for maximising the value and performance of Martech and Adtech for businesses in multiple sectors.
  • Strong technical expertise and experience with tag management and tracking, analytics, data management (CDPs, DMPs & data warehouses), media & ad platforms and BI tools.
  • Great soft skills: we’re highly client-facing.

A bit more about the role:

We’re a hybrid agency and consultancy with a brilliant track record for driving growth through the application of data and technology for our clients. As Marketing Technology Manager within our team, you’ll be developing our strategic approach to technology and deliver great work for our clients.

What you’ll do:

  • Support the selection, implementation, and integration of client Martech solutions (e.g. GA4, GTM, CDPs, DMPs and A/B testing tools).
  • Own the technical setup and QA of tracking infrastructure across client websites, landing pages, and e-commerce platforms.
  • Support clients on setting and implementing optimal web analytics set up (GA4, Adobe).
  • Set up advanced conversion tracking, attribution models, and event-based user flows using tools like Google Tag Manager, Segment, and Mixpanel.
  • Manage Ad ops – Pixel, cAPI, server-side tracking across paid platforms.
  • Conduct root cause analyses for operational issues and recommend technical solutions.
  • Proactively explore emerging technologies, Martech tools, and best practices to drive innovation in SEM.
  • Support our In Science team on data flows into BI platforms and automated reporting.
  • Support on Martech strategy during pitch processes and client onboarding.
  • Keeping up to date with privacy and cookie related news agenda - circulating and coming up with the In Digital advice and relaying this to our clients.

A bit more about you:

  • Hands-on experience with Google Tag Manager (must have) and Martech platforms – including default and custom tags set up and debugging of tags.
  • Strong experience using website analytics platforms: GA4 (must have), Adobe, Amplitude, Mixpanel.
  • Analytical mindset - comfortable handling quantitative data.
  • An interest and an understanding of other digital marketing areas and how they interlock with Martech.
  • Hands-on experience using HTML/CSS and JavaScript to debug and implement tag deployment and triggers.
  • Strong project management, able to handle multiple projects/workstreams at the same time, and working with stakeholders.
